Green Party retain their seat in Brighton Pavilion

May 8, 2015 by Jeffrey Buchanan 1 Comment

Caroline Lucas has retained her seat in Brighton Pavillion to give the Green party its only seat of the 2015 election.

Lucas originally held the seat from the 2010 election.

Green count was 22,871

Conservative count was 12,448

Socialist Party of Great Britain count was 88

Labour count was 14,904

Independent Yeomans count was 116

UKIP count was 2724

This is her second term in the seat.
